adapted to be engine drawn. and used in An object of the present invention is to provide means for automatically lifting the plows and holding the same above the ground surface when the plows are not in use, and for automatically dropping the plows to the desired distance in the earth when the plows are in use; and to provide means for engaging or measuring the depth of the plows relatively to a prior formed furrow, or furrow turned up by an advanced plow. v
The invention also has for an object the provision of a peculiar mounting for'awheel upon a plow beam for supporting the latter by the wheel, and also for raising and lowering the beam by the vertical movement of the wheel whenfrolled into and out of furrow; and to provide a wheel mounting or connection comprising relatively few parts and which are automatically moved relatively to one another incident to the change in the angle of the plow beam relatively to a draft frame employed.

Slidably mounted in the. guide 15 is one end beam 2 of an arm 16, which end is relatively straight;
and adapted 'for'vertical movementfin' the guide. The arm 16' is bowed upwardly and has its other end relatively long and projecting down toward the ground in laterally spaced relation from theplane of theibeam 12.) "Thelonger'end'ofthe armf16 has piv. oted thereto a combined supporting 'and liftingwheel 17, and isprovided with a base '18 forming with thelower'end of the arm 16 a fork within which the wheel'17 is-mountedf Thewheel 17 V and its arm 16are adapted to rise and fall as thejwheel passes over undulations in the groundv The inner end of the arm'16 is provided with a pivot 19, shown-in Fig. 7 in the form of a bolt, and upon-which is pivotally mounted between its ends a lever20. One
end of the lever20, the rearend thereof, is
connected by a link 21 to the rear end of the adjacent plow beam 12, while the outer or forward end of the lever 20 is connected by a rod 22 to a depending bracket 23 carried upon the rear end of the draft frame 10. The connecting rod 22 is of such length that when the plow is drawn over the upper 'irface of the earth with the supporting and lifting wheel 17 traveling substantially in the same horizontal plane as that of the carrier wheels of the draft frame 10, the lifting lever will be swung upon the link 21 'ito a position to force the arm 16 downwardly and thus raise the beam 12, and the plow points 14 connected thereto. The lever 20 and the connecting rod 22 are of such relative length that the plow points 14: are elevated a considerable distance above the surface of the ground when the combined lifting and supporting wheel 17 is traveling thereover. As shown in Fig. 1, however, as soon as the lifting wheel 17 drops into a' furrow, the angle between the draft frame 10 and the plow beam 12 is lessened and approaches a straight angle with the result that the linear distance between the pivotal point of the lever 20 upon the arm 16 and the forward end of the connecting rod upon the draft frame 10 is lessened and the forward end of the lever 20 is raised and the beams 12 are lowered. The connecting rod 22 is of a predetermined length in order to drop the plow points 14 into the ground the desired distance. The arm 16 is so curved that the ends thereof substantially bridge the space between the furrow formed by the adjacent plow 14 and the prior formed furrow. The supporting wheel 17 is adapted to travel in the prior formed furrow and to, thus adjust, automatically, the position of the plow points 14 in the ground to form the new furrows.
